This gent's job for the day is to tend the fire and make sure the pots don't boil dry or boil over.

The two four-gallon pots will contain enough food to feed three generations of the family.

My best guess at the contents is bacon bones, and vegetables washed in the stainless steel bowl that the woman is holding.

Mrs Red calls me "An old pot watcher"

Apparently, tonight's full moon is very close to the earth so it looks 14% bigger.

The moon gets closer to the earth?

It's got an elliptical orbit.

It's about a quarter of a miillion miles away from the earth at it's furthest and gets about 30000 miles closer at it's closest.
